## Deployment

BrambleKV ships with a bloom filter sitting in front of the main store to cut needless disk lookups on cache misses. The filter is rebuilt at startup from the live keyspace, so first boot after a restore can take a few minutes. Deploy the filter sidecar before the store itself; ordering matters because the store refuses writes until the filter reports ready. The settings the release build must carry are as follows.

settings of tagef-bawif:
DRUIX_HOST=druix.zemvarlabs.internal
DRUIX_PORT=8000

- [ ] Step 7: Archive cold storage buckets (Glacierline tier). Confirm both ceremony witnesses are present, verify bucket manifests match the Oxbow ledger, then seal the archive key shares. Plugin authors may observe but not handle shares. Once sealed, the archive index itself is encrypted and can only be reopened with the passphrase below.

vault phrase of badup-hahig = tamael-aldael-kelmir-istael-fenok-istwyn-tamius-jorath-oliion

When the Lanefill address autocomplete widget starts returning empty suggestion lists, first confirm the upstream gazetteer service is healthy before restarting anything. The widget caches its suggestion index aggressively, so a restart without a cache flush will usually reproduce the fault within minutes. Marguerite from the Platform pod added a drain endpoint last sprint; call it first, wait for the queue to empty, then restart the pods one at a time. Each pod reads its settings from the environment at boot, exactly as listed here.

settings of yahig-baweg:
[istael]
host = istael.qorvellabs.corp
user = istael_svc
database = istael_prod

Onboarding note for the Ledgerpane admin table: bulk edits are applied through the batcher service, not directly against the database. Select rows, choose an action, and the batcher stages changes in a pending set you can review before commit. Edits over 500 rows require a second approver — this is enforced server-side, so don't try to chunk around it. To run the batcher locally you need the staging write credential, which goes in your .env as the next line.

secret setting of bahip-kagag: RELAY_SECRET3=c83